## Configuration

Reviewers: the websocket reconnect bug in Tidewire stemmed from the backoff ceiling being read once at boot. This branch moves it to `WS_RECONNECT_MAX_MS`, re-read on each reconnect attempt, with jitter controlled by `WS_JITTER_PCT`. Please verify the defaults (30000 and 20) match the incident runbook. The reconnect handshake also signs its resume token, so the environment file must include the signing credential on the following line:

sealed setting: VAULT_KEY20=c8ea1e419912889df6b4

Q: Why did my canary get held at 5% on Farrowdeck? A: Gating requires two green soak windows, error rate under baseline, and no open sev-2 on the service. Manual overrides need approval from the release captain — don't ping infra directly. Holds auto-expire after 24h and revert. The full gating ruleset, current thresholds, and override history live on the internal page listed below.

dashboard of hawep-tajog = https://sentry.zemvarforge.local/deploy/board/projects/dash/3f4a2a2e752a0508

Ticket RB-883 — Hey on-call: the Tallyforge report builder's sort-stability fix (ties now preserve input order) is ready, but the signing vault locked after the Bramwick deploy job hammered it. Can't ship the patch until it's open again. Break-glass procedure applies; the recovery passphrase is right below.

unlock words, kajef-kadug: sorys-pelax-lamael-tamvan-briiel-novdor-fenwyn-tamdor-oliion-keleth-julok-belion-ralok